Box unveils the Box Agent to transform how enterprises work with content
Blog post from Box
Box, Inc. has announced the general availability of its new AI-powered Box Agent, designed to revolutionize how enterprises handle unstructured data by autonomously executing complex tasks using natural language instructions. Leveraging advanced reasoning models from leading AI organizations like OpenAI, Anthropic, and Google, the Box Agent functions within Box's Intelligent Content Management platform, ensuring enterprise-grade security and governance. The Box Agent enables users to search company files, generate new content, and analyze data while respecting permissions, enhancing productivity across procurement, sales, and marketing teams. Additionally, Box AI Studio has been updated to allow admins to create custom AI agents tailored to business-specific use cases, operationalizing expertise at scale. Available to customers on Enterprise Plus and Enterprise Advanced plans, the Box Agent offers features like Pro Mode for advanced logic tasks and Expanded Mode for processing extensive workloads, while the ability to create new files in multiple formats is currently in beta for Enterprise Advanced customers.
